Как написать чат на websocket'ax (javascript)?

Здравствуйте, достаточно давно хочу понять само строение чатов, а точнее написать свой простенький чат на websocket'ax (на javascript'e, и, соответственно, с node.js).
Внятных туториалов я как-то не нашёл, да и точно api websocket'ов не смог найти, подскажите пожалуйста >.
  • Вопрос задан
  • 5629 просмотров
Решения вопроса 1
DIITHiTech
@DIITHiTech
Fullstack javascript developer
socket.io
socket.io/demos/chat
https://github.com/socketio/socket.io/tree/master/...

Без этой библиотеки у Вас пока ничего не получится, ведь кроме клиента нужен сервер, который и реализуется этой прослойкой, писать же свой- глупое занятие + что то мне подсказывает что Вам пытаться делать этот велосипед еще рановато.
Вы можете отказаться только от клиентской прослойки библиотек, которые позволяют примерно эмулировать работу web сокетов в старых браузерах через ajax и более древние техники, но не от сервера. В javascript нету ничего о веб сокетах, с клиентской стороны это интерфейсы браузера, а на nodejs сервере все нужно реализовывать самому, или через те библиотеки, которые Вы не хотите.

Базис о клиентских сокетах в браузере почитать можно тут:
https://developer.mozilla.org/en-US/docs/Web/API/W...
Ответ написан
Комментировать
Пригласить эксперта
Ответы на вопрос 2
C++Qt + PHP + WorkerMan: Чат на WebSocket'ах
Ответ написан
Комментировать
somakun
@somakun
Фронтенд програмист
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ы